// BUG: Some vulkan implementations don't like the 'clear' loadop renderpass.
// For example, the ImgTec VK driver fails if you try to use a framebuffer with a different
// load/store op than that which it was created with, despite the spec saying they should be
// compatible.
// Started Version: 1.7
// Ended Version: 1.10
BUG_BROKEN_CLEAR_LOADOP_RENDERPASS,
